Orlando Looks to Defend Home Turf Against D.C. United
As the MLS season heads into its critical final stretch, Orlando City SC hosts D.C. United in a crucial Eastern Conference clash. Playing at home, Orlando enters as a slight +110 favorite, but they face challenges coming out of the recent international break. D.C. United, meanwhile, arrives in Florida as a +200 underdog, looking to play spoiler and snatch valuable road points.
Orlando City SC Outlook
Orlando City comes into this matchup facing a significant variable: player fatigue and reintegration. According to recent club news, the Lions had eight players away on international duty during the September window. While this speaks to the quality on their roster, it raises questions about their readiness for this midweek fixture. Head coach Óscar Pareja will need to manage his squad’s fitness carefully, as players returning from international travel and competition may not be at 100%.
Despite these potential challenges, Orlando is favored for a reason. They have been a formidable opponent at Exploria Stadium, and the odds reflect confidence in their ability to secure a result. Their success will depend on how quickly their key international players can slot back into the team and find their rhythm against a determined D.C. side.
